Handover note — Crumbwheel order cutoffs.

Welcome aboard. The bakery cutoff rule in Crumbwheel closes same-day orders at 14:00 local to each storefront, not UTC — this has bitten us twice. Holiday overrides live in the calendar service and take precedence silently, so always check there first when a cutoff looks wrong. To unlock the calendar service's admin console after a restart, enter the recovery passphrase below.

vault phrase of bagap-bahaf = silion-pelox-sorox-casdor-quenwyn-fraax-eliox-praael-kelion-quenvan-kasox-rusael-norius-belvan

### Audit item 14 — Template rendering performance

Heads up, support crew: this check covers the Quillbox rendering layer. Confirm that average template render time stayed under 120ms for the audit period and that the slow-render alert actually fired during last month's load test (it missed once before, so double-check). If the dashboards disagree with the logs, flag it rather than guessing. Sign-off on this item can't come from support — it needs the performance owner, who is named below.

named custodian: Belius Casath Ulaix Sorius

Fan-out backpressure for the Quillet notifier: when the queue depth crosses the soft limit, the dispatcher sheds low-priority pushes and batches the rest at 500ms intervals. Reviewer should confirm the shed counter is exported and that retries respect the jitter window. Once merged, the release artifact gets re-signed by the pipeline, which expects the deploy key shown below.

deploy key for bawep-yawif: bky6_GQhaSt

## Deployment

The Graxley retention sweeper runs as a single replica on the `vault-purge` node pool. Deploy via the standard pipeline; the sweeper drains before restart, so no manual pause is needed. If a sweep is mid-run, the restart waits up to ten minutes. Verify the purge counter advances after rollout. The sweeper reads the following values at startup.

deployment values, yahag-tawef:
ZORWYN_HOST=zorwyn.tolvaqlabs.internal
ZORWYN_PORT=9300